:-: Julian Assange



01 December 2010

Sweden authorizes INTERPOL to make public Red Notice for WikiLeaks founder





ASSANGE
Julian Paul


LYON, France - INTERPOL has made public the Red Notice, or international wanted persons alert, for WikiLeaks founder Julian Assange at the request of Swedish authorities who want to question him in connection with a number of sexual offences.
The Red Notice for the 39-year-old Australian, which was issued to law enforcement in all 188 INTERPOL member countries on 20 November, has now been made publicly available by INTERPOL following official authorization by Sweden.
All INTERPOL National Central Bureaus (NCBs) have also been advised to ensure that their border control agencies are made aware of Assange's Red Notice status, which is a request for any country to identify or locate an individual with a view to their provisional arrest and extradition.
Many of INTERPOL's member countries however, consider a Red Notice a valid request for provisional arrest, especially if they are linked to the requesting country via a bilateral extradition treaty. In cases where arrests are made based on a Red Notice, these are made by national police officials in INTERPOL member countries.
INTERPOL cannot demand that any member country arrests the subject of a Red Notice. Any individual wanted for arrest should be considered innocent until proven guilty.

:-: Kuwait Dependency Renewal

Following are needed for extending the dependency visa.


  1. Sponsors Civil Id copy
  2. Dependants Civil Id copy
  3. Dependants passport copy with husbands or wifes name included
  4. Dependants Two photographs
  5. Medical insurance 
  6. 10 kd stamp
  7. and filled up application form.

Depends up on your fate, the processing time can be ....

:-: Kuwait Medical insurance renewal

Following Docs are needed to renew the Medical insurance of the Dependants:

  1. Sponsors Civil Id copy
  2. One passport photo copy of the Dependant. [Blue background]
  3. Dependants Civil Id copy
  4. Dependants Medical insurance card
  5. 40KD as fee for 1yr for adult. 35 for children.
  6. 1 KD for the card.

Go to the nearest Govt insurance center. It will hardly take half an hour to get a new one. Preferably go at 5pm - it is open till 6pm :). Morning sessions are also available.


:-: Kuwait Visit Visa docs

The below are the documents required to obtain a Visit Visa for :
a. Wife
b. Offspring
c. Parents
d. Father & Mother in laws.

Documents:
  1. Filled up application form - Arabic.
  2. Passport copy of the traveler
  3. Indian embassy Attested & Kuwait foreign affairs Singed Sponsor Relation ship affidavit
  4. Sponsor civil id copy
  5. Sponsor Salary certificate
  6. Indian embassy Attested & Kuwait foreign affairs Singed Sponsor marriage certificate
  7. Wife civil id copy
  8. Rental agreement
  9. Last months rental receipt.
  10. 3kd stamp.

Keep the originals along with you.

It will hardly take one working day to get the Visa issued. Send the original to the traveler and happy waiting.


The rules may change accordingly - check with the Jawazzat for the latest updates. The monthly salary of the sponsor should be greater that 450KD.

:-: My Cycling days


Most of you might be wondering what this image is and its relevance in this page.

I was an active participant of Kerala state cycling championship for Eigth consecutive years, in which I got several honors. Represented Kerala in All India National Cycling Championship many times.

Talking about Cycling its an endless story to me.... Below you can the cycle, with Low Profile Colnago Frame and Handle, Two disc wheels, Russian tubular s, Shimano gears etc...



I had a Colnago track cycle which cost around Rs 20,000 in 1990, imported from Australia and a Malasiayan assembled Road event cycle with 12 gear changers costing around 10,000 INR. First was hardly around 3 kilos of weight and the later some 4 kilos extra.



Check the width of the Tyre


At that point of time I was an expert in assembling, fixing and re alaigning a race cycle completely.


Below is my regular usage BSA SLR model which cost around One thousand and weight some kilos. I go to my school in this single brake cycle.
